Transaction 127cbc92eeea1a6116b51f1033d298d5c21514f95916f640b004beec8690435a
3 Input
2 Outputs
- 127cbc92eeea1a6116b51f1033d298d5c21514f95916f640b004beec8690435a:0
- 127cbc92eeea1a6116b51f1033d298d5c21514f95916f640b004beec8690435a:1
value 1151680
address 1G2K1sktvUyuuxPeGHVaYdSfLizZaVAy54
value 685025346
address 1EtgR7GxhE9S6byepPxb29PG25aq7psT9n